How many NFL teams were there 1960?

How many NFL teams were there 1960?

13 teams
The 1960 NFL season was the 41st regular season of the National Football League. Before the season, Pete Rozelle was elected NFL commissioner as a compromise choice on the twenty-third ballot. Meanwhile, the league expanded to 13 teams with the addition of the Dallas Cowboys.

How many NFL teams were there in 1961?

14 teams
The 1961 NFL season was the 42nd regular season of the National Football League (NFL). The league expanded to 14 teams with the addition of the Minnesota Vikings, after the team’s owners declined to be charter members of the new American Football League.

How many NFL teams were there in 1950?

NFL seasons The 1950 NFL season was the 31st regular season of the National Football League. The merger with the All-America Football Conference (AAFC) expanded the league to 13 teams.

Which NFL teams were in existence in 1960?

The Dallas Cowboys, first known as the Dallas Steers, then the Dallas Rangers, were the NFL’s first modern-era expansion team formed in 1960. The NFL awarded Dallas the franchise after the 1960 college draft had been held.

Who won NFL Championship in 1960?

In 1960, the Eagles won their third NFL championship, under the leadership of future Pro Football Hall of Famers Norm Van Brocklin and Chuck Bednarik ; the head coach was Buck Shaw.
